GUIGUI wrote:Why is the matrix cover systematically put in the wrong way? Every pics I see of him use the front plate side of the truck instead of the Matrix cover side. Why?


I think most of the figures have it both ways in the galleries I've posted. The problem is Takara does pictures of it with the screws facing out and Hasbro does it with the screws facing in. I prefer it with the screws facing in like Hasbro's pictures ... I don't like seeing 2 screws through his windshield.

Oddly enough, that's how Hasbro even packaged their last version. Observe ...
